Почему стили CSS не применяются, даже если все правильно написано?

Почему мой рабочий процесс перестал функционировать без изменений со времени последнего редактирования?
  • 23 ноября 2023 г. 16:30
Ответы на вопрос 1
Есть множество возможных причин, почему стили CSS могут не применяться, несмотря на правильное написание кода. Вот некоторые из них:

1. Кэширование браузера: Браузеры иногда кэшируют файлы CSS, чтобы ускорить загрузку страниц. Если вы вносите изменения в файлы CSS, но они не отображаются, попробуйте очистить кэш браузера или использовать комбинацию клавиш Ctrl + F5 для полной перезагрузки страницы.

2. Порядок подключения стилей: Если у вас есть несколько файлов CSS, убедитесь, что они подключаются в правильном порядке. Если один файл содержит стили, которые переопределяют другие, убедитесь, что этот файл подключается после остальных.

3. Ошибки в CSS коде: Если в CSS коде есть ошибки, браузер может игнорировать или неправильно применять стили. Убедитесь, что все синтаксически правильно записано, включая закрытие скобок, точки с запятой и правильное использование селекторов.

4. Селекторы не соответствуют элементам: Убедитесь, что ваши CSS селекторы правильно соответствуют элементам HTML на странице. Если вы используете классы или идентификаторы, убедитесь, что они применены к соответствующим элементам.

5. Вес селектора: Если у вас есть несколько правил CSS, которые применяются к одному и тому же элементу, браузер будет применять стиль с более высоким весом. Убедитесь, что ваш стиль имеет достаточно высокий вес, чтобы переопределить другие стили.

6. Не правильно указанный путь к файлу CSS: Проверьте, что путь к файлу CSS указан правильно. Удостоверьтесь, что путь указан относительно корневой папки вашего проекта.

7. Не учтены стили при наследовании: Если у родительского элемента есть стили, которые применяются к дочернему элементу через наследование, ваши стили могут не работать. Проверьте, применяются ли стили в родительском элементе или установите свои собственные стили для дочернего элемента.

Наиболее вероятно, проблема в одном из вышеперечисленных пунктов. Рекомендуется последовательно пройти через каждый пункт и устранить возможные проблемы.
Похожие вопросы